dc.description.abstractIn this paper, a new monopole compact antenna with tunable frequency fed by a coplanarwaveguide (CPW) for WiMAX, WLAN, LTE bands, and X-band satellite communication system ispresented. This is achieved by adequate combination of a new radiating patch element along with slotsand switches. The simulation and measurement results show that depending on ON/OFF states, theproposed reconfigurable antenna, printed on an FR4 substrate, can operate in four applicable frequencybands, i.e., [2.37–2.75 GHz], [3.15–4.08 GHz], [4.48–5.92 GHz], and [6.69–8.31 GHz]. Very interestingresults for the reflection coefficient, current distribution, and radiation pattern of the antenna arepresented and discussed. The measured results are in good agreement with the simulated onesen_US
